180 def ns_list(ctx, filter, long):
181 """list all NS instances
182
183 \b
184 Options:
185 --filter filterExpr Restricts the list to the NS instances matching the filter
186
187 \b
188 filterExpr consists of one or more strings formatted according to "simpleFilterExpr",
189 concatenated using the "&" character:
190
191 \b
192 filterExpr := <simpleFilterExpr>["&"<simpleFilterExpr>]*
193 simpleFilterExpr := <attrName>["."<attrName>]*["."<op>]"="<value>[","<value>]*
194 op := "eq" | "neq" | "gt" | "lt" | "gte" | "lte" | "cont" | "ncont"
195 attrName := string
196 value := scalar value
197
198 \b
199 where:
200 * zero or more occurrences
201 ? zero or one occurrence
202 [] grouping of expressions to be used with ? and *
203 "" quotation marks for marking string constants
204 <> name separator
205
206 \b
207 "AttrName" is the name of one attribute in the data type that defines the representation
208 of the resource. The dot (".") character in "simpleFilterExpr" allows concatenation of
209 <attrName> entries to filter by attributes deeper in the hierarchy of a structured document.
210 "Op" stands for the comparison operator. If the expression has concatenated <attrName>
211 entries, it means that the operator "op" is applied to the attribute addressed by the last
212 <attrName> entry included in the concatenation. All simple filter expressions are combined
213 by the "AND" logical operator. In a concatenation of <attrName> entries in a <simpleFilterExpr>,
214 the rightmost "attrName" entry in a "simpleFilterExpr" is called "leaf attribute". The
215 concatenation of all "attrName" entries except the leaf attribute is called the "attribute
216 prefix". If an attribute referenced in an expression is an array, an object that contains a
217 corresponding array shall be considered to match the expression if any of the elements in the
218 array matches all expressions that have the same attribute prefix.
219
220 \b
221 Filter examples:
222 --filter admin-status=ENABLED
223 --filter nsd-ref=<NSD_NAME>
224 --filter nsd.vendor=<VENDOR>
225 --filter nsd.vendor=<VENDOR>&nsd-ref=<NSD_NAME>
226 --filter nsd.constituent-vnfd.vnfd-id-ref=<VNFD_NAME>
227 """
